双缓冲技术原理以及优缺点

创建一幅后台图像,将每一帧画入图像,然后调用 drawImage()方法将整个后台图像一次画到屏幕上去。
优点:双缓冲技术的优点在于大部分绘制是离屏的。将离屏图像一次绘至屏幕上,比直接在屏幕上绘制要有效得多。双缓冲技术可以使动画平滑。
缺点:要分配一个后台图像的缓冲,如果图像相当大,这将占用很大一块内存。

Java GUI库画图时实现双缓冲:
双缓冲技术原理以及优缺点

双缓冲技术原理以及优缺点